About Jonathan Windram

Jonathan Windram is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Surgery, Epidemiology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, having authored 41 papers that have together received 496 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Congenital Heart Disease Studies (13 papers),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(9 papers), Cardiovascular Issues in Pregnancy (9 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(8 papers), Cardiomyopathy and Myosin Studies (5 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(5 papers), Heart Failure Treatment and Management (3 papers) and Ultrasound in Clinical Applications (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(269 citations), Developmental Neuroscience (38 citations),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ine (44 cit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(23 citations) and Epidemiology (135 citations). Jonathan Windram has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United Kingdom and United States. Frequent co-authors include Lars Grosse‐Wortmann, Shi‐Joon Yoo, John G.F. Cleland, Andrew L. Clark, I. Hanning, Alan S. Rigby, Mark W. Crawford, Andrew N. Redington, Colin J. McMahon and Justin T. Tretter. Their work appears in journals such as Canadian Journal of Cardiology, American Heart Journal, Congenital Heart Disease, International Journal of Cardiology and European Heart Journal - Cardiovascular Imaging.
